Intelligent Electric Grids Market: AI-Powered Energy Management, Smart Grid Innovations, and Resilient Infrastructure 2024-2034

Intelligent Electric Grids Market is anticipated to expand from 7.5 billion in 2024 to 21.8 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of approximately 11.3%.

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market encompasses the development and deployment of smart grid technologies that enhance the efficiency, reliability, and sustainability of electricity distribution. This market includes advanced metering infrastructure, grid automation, demand response systems, and energy management solutions, facilitating real-time monitoring and control of energy flows. It supports the integration of renewable energy sources, reduces transmission losses, and enables dynamic pricing, paving the way for a more resilient and adaptive power infrastructure.

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market is experiencing robust growth propelled by technological advancements and increasing energy efficiency demands. Advanced Metering Infrastructure (AMI) leads the segments, driven by its critical role in data collection and energy management. Distribution Management Systems (DMS) emerge as the second-highest performing sub-segment, reflecting the need for real-time monitoring and improved grid reliability. North America dominates the regional market, benefiting from substantial investments in smart grid technologies and government initiatives. Europe follows closely, with countries like Germany and the United Kingdom spearheading advancements due to their focus on renewable energy integration and smart city projects. The Asia-Pacific region, particularly China and India, is witnessing rapid adoption, fueled by urbanization and energy consumption growth. Innovations in grid automation and increased R&D investments are further expanding the market’s potential, positioning intelligent grids as a cornerstone for sustainable energy solutions globally.

In 2024, the Intelligent Electric Grids Market is characterized by a robust volume, with the smart meters segment commanding a significant 45% market share. Distribution automation follows closely with 30%, while advanced energy storage solutions account for 25%. The market is driven by the increasing adoption of renewable energy sources and the need for efficient energy management. The deployment of smart grid technologies is particularly prevalent in North America and Europe, regions that collectively contribute to over 60% of the market volume. Key players such as Siemens AG, General Electric, and Schneider Electric dominate, leveraging their technological advancements and strategic partnerships.

Geographical Overview

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market is witnessing significant growth across different regions, each contributing uniquely to the market dynamics. North America stands at the forefront, driven by substantial investments in smart grid technologies and government initiatives promoting energy efficiency. The United States, with its advanced infrastructure and focus on renewable energy integration, plays a pivotal role in this regional dominance.

Europe follows closely, with countries like Germany and the United Kingdom leading the charge. The region’s commitment to reducing carbon emissions and enhancing grid reliability fuels its market expansion. European Union policies supporting smart grid deployment further bolster this growth.

Asia Pacific emerges as a promising market, propelled by rapid urbanization and industrialization in countries such as China and India. These nations are investing significantly in modernizing their electricity infrastructure to meet rising energy demands. Government policies promoting smart grid adoption and renewable energy integration drive the market forward.

Latin America is also gaining traction, with Brazil and Mexico at the helm. The region’s focus on improving grid efficiency and reducing energy losses is a key growth driver. Initiatives to integrate renewable energy sources into the grid further enhance market potential.

The Middle East and Africa region, though in the nascent stages, shows potential for growth. Investments in smart grid technologies and renewable energy projects in countries like the United Arab Emirates and South Africa are paving the way for future market expansion.

Recent Developments

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market is undergoing transformative shifts driven by technological advancements and policy changes. Pricing structures vary significantly, ranging from $100,000 to over $1 million for comprehensive grid solutions. This variance is largely influenced by the complexity and scale of implementation. Demand is surging, particularly in regions like North America and Europe, where grid modernization is prioritized to improve efficiency and reliability. Key consumers include utility companies and government agencies focused on sustainable energy management.

Regulatory frameworks are pivotal, with mandates for renewable energy integration and grid resilience shaping market dynamics. Compliance with standards such as IEEE and IEC is essential, affecting operational costs and market entry strategies. The market is characterized by several trends. Firstly, the integration of AI and machine learning is enhancing grid analytics, enabling predictive maintenance and reducing downtime. Companies like Siemens and GE are pioneering these innovations.

Secondly, there is a growing emphasis on cybersecurity, as smart grids become more interconnected and vulnerable to cyber threats. Thirdly, the deployment of distributed energy resources, such as solar panels and wind turbines, is increasing, necessitating advanced grid management solutions. Finally, partnerships between technology firms and energy providers are driving the development of smart grid infrastructure, with collaborations like Schneider Electric and IBM leading the way in creating intelligent, adaptive grid systems.

Market Drivers and Trends

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market is experiencing robust growth, driven by several key trends and drivers. Increasing urbanization and the consequent rise in energy demand are primary drivers. Cities are expanding, necessitating more efficient and reliable energy distribution systems. Intelligent grids offer solutions to manage these growing demands effectively.

Technological advancements, notably in IoT and AI, are transforming grid management. These technologies enable real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and enhanced grid resilience. Such innovations improve operational efficiency and reduce downtime, making them attractive to energy providers. Furthermore, the integration of renewable energy sources is a significant trend. As countries commit to reducing carbon emissions, intelligent grids facilitate the seamless incorporation of solar and wind energy into existing infrastructures.

Government policies and incentives are also propelling the market forward. Many nations are investing in smart grid technologies to enhance energy security and sustainability. Additionally, consumer demand for reliable and clean energy is encouraging utilities to adopt intelligent grid solutions. As a result, the market is poised for significant expansion, with opportunities in both developed and emerging economies. Companies that innovate and adapt to these trends will likely capture substantial market share.

Market Restraints and Challenges

The Intelligent Electric Grids Market encounters several pressing restraints and challenges. A significant challenge is the substantial initial investment required for infrastructure development, which can deter stakeholders from committing resources. Additionally, the integration of advanced technologies demands skilled personnel, yet there is a notable shortage of expertise in the sector. This skills gap can hinder the effective implementation and operation of intelligent grids. Furthermore, cybersecurity remains a critical concern, as these grids are increasingly susceptible to sophisticated cyber threats that can compromise grid stability and data integrity. Regulatory complexities also pose a challenge, with varying standards and policies across regions complicating the deployment and interoperability of grid systems. Lastly, the aging infrastructure in many areas requires substantial upgrades to support intelligent grid functionalities, adding to the financial and logistical burdens faced by utility companies. These challenges collectively impede the rapid adoption and expansion of intelligent electric grids worldwide.
